丽知:钉钉补推报错提示修改

This commit is contained in:
zhengyf 2024-11-29 10:42:20 +08:00
parent 3980ec0570
commit c713bc095b
2 changed files with 12 additions and 4 deletions

View File

@ -78,7 +78,7 @@ public class DingU8CBillController extends DefaultController {
}
return getSuccessMessageEntity("根据Id补推",query);
}catch (Exception e){
return getFailureMessageEntity("根据Id补推失败,失败原因:{}",e.getMessage());
return getFailureMessageEntity("根据Id补推失败",e.getMessage());
}
}

View File

@ -104,15 +104,18 @@ public class DingU8cBillServiceImpl extends BaseService<DingU8cBillEntity, Strin
*/
@Override
public DingU8cBillEntity pushById(DingU8cBillEntity dingU8cBillEntity) {
try{
DingU8cBillEntity dingU8cBillEntityNew=null;
Assert.notNull(dingU8cBillEntity,"dingU8cBillEntity不能未空");
Assert.notNull(dingU8cBillEntity.getId(),"ID不能未空");
dingU8cBillEntity.setInitiate(null);
List<DingU8cBillEntity> query = dingU8cBillDao.query(dingU8cBillEntity);
try{
if(query.size()==0){
Assert.state(false,"根据id{},查询失败,未查询到数据。",dingU8cBillEntity.getId());
}
DingU8cBillEntity dingU8cBillEntityNew = query.get(0);
dingU8cBillEntityNew = query.get(0);
//没有推送成功的
if(dingU8cBillEntityNew.getDing_talk_process_id()==null||"".equals(dingU8cBillEntityNew.getDing_talk_process_id().trim())){
@ -156,7 +159,12 @@ public class DingU8cBillServiceImpl extends BaseService<DingU8cBillEntity, Strin
}
return dingU8cBillEntityNew;
}catch (Exception e){
Assert.state(false,e.getMessage());
if(dingU8cBillEntityNew != null){
Assert.state(false,"根据公司编码:{},单据号:{}实例id{}补推失败,失败原因:{}",e.getMessage());
}else {
Assert.state(false,e.getMessage());
}
}
return null;
}